Advantages of Using Red Wigglers



Although numerous fishermens might overlook the choice of bait, making use of red wigglers offers several distinct benefits that can enhance angling success. Red wigglers are very appealing to a wide range of freshwater fish due to their all-natural fragrance and activity in the water. Their wriggling activity mimics that of a real-time victim, making them a luring choice for fish seeking a nutritious dish.


Furthermore, red wigglers are flexible and can be used in numerous angling methods, including bottom fishing and bobber configurations. Their capacity to remain on the hook without dropping off easily makes them perfect for extensive fishing sessions. Red wigglers are easily available and affordable, often calling for marginal investment for fishermens looking to improve their bait selection.


Additionally, these worms are eco friendly and add to sustainable fishing techniques. They are a natural food resource that does not disrupt regional ecological communities when made use of responsibly. In general, the unification of red wigglers right into a fishermen's lure collection can lead to boosted catch rates, making them a worthwhile consideration for both novice and experienced anglers.

Sorts Of Fish Brought In



Red wigglers are not only advantageous for their convenience of use and availability; they likewise bring in a diverse range of fish varieties, making them a flexible choice for fishermens. These dynamic worms are particularly efficient in drawing freshwater varieties, including bluegill, perch, and crappie. Their natural activities and appealing aroma make them irresistible to panfish, usually resulting in effective catches.


(Red Wiggler Express)Furthermore, red wigglers can attract larger types such as bass and catfish. Bass, understood for their aggressive feeding habits, are drawn to the wriggling activity of red wigglers, particularly throughout the warmer months when they are proactively searching for protein-rich food. In a similar way, catfish are recognized to favor these worms, as they flourish on high-protein lures and are brought in to the strong scent.

Exactly How to Utilize Red Wigglers



Efficient use of red wigglers as bait calls for understanding their optimum presentation and handling. These worms are especially effective because of their all-natural motion, which can entice fish. To start, select healthy, dynamic red wigglers, as their task degree directly influences their attractiveness to fish.


Insert the hook through the head or a belly, making sure that a section of the worm hangs freely. Depending on the dimension of the fish targeted, you might make use of one or multiple worms on the hook.


Moreover, take into consideration the depth and place of your fishing. Red wigglers prosper in freshwater atmospheres, making them appropriate for usage near the bottom or in locations with enough cover, such as rocks or immersed greenery.


Finest Areas for Angling



Determining the best places for fishing is vital for maximizing success and enjoyment on the water. Key factors to consider when selecting fishing places consist of water depth, framework, and the visibility of natural food resources.


Lakes and ponds are excellent selections, particularly those with immersed structures like dropped trees, rocks, or aquatic plant life, as these attract fish seeking shelter and food - Fishing Worm bait. Rivers and streams also present abundant opportunities, especially in locations with differing current speeds and eddies where fish might congregate


Coastal regions offer one-of-a-kind environments, such as tidal flats and estuaries, which can yield a selection of deep sea species. For anglers targeting larger fish, offshore angling in deeper waters is frequently gratifying.


Furthermore, take into consideration seasonal modifications; fish actions differs with temperature level, generating cycles, and food availability. Local understanding can be invaluable, so talk to fellow anglers or regional bait shops to determine preferred places.
